Reduced noise
A double-glazed window is the best solution to reduce noise in your home. It can block out noises from outside like barking dogs traffic noise, and many other sounds from entering your home, allowing you to sleep peacefully at nights and allowing for a more comfortable living space.
Noise reduction is an essential aspect of soundproofing because it can have a significant impact on your health and well-being. It can have a significant impact on your quality of life including your mood, sleep and stress levels at home.
The majority of windows, single or double glazed transmit noise to the inside of your home through a process called diffusion. This happens when pressure waves from the outside travel through the frame, air gaps and panes.
The thickness of the glass, air gap and frame can all play a role in reducing noise. A thicker glass can dampen the transmission of high-frequency sounds and an air gap that is smaller can lessen the vibrations of low frequency sound.
It's important to remember that the seals and frame are as crucial as the glass itself when it comes to eliminating noise. They can be damaged or damaged and cause a lot more sound leakage into your home.
Inspecting your window frames as well as seals professionally caulked is an important aspect of soundproofing your windows. This can eliminate any small gaps that allow the sound to pass through.
Another way to cut down on the transmission of sound is installing noise-reducing window film on the windows you already have. It is crucial to apply it correctly as it could alter the appearance of your windows and create blurred vision.
To properly reduce noise it is important to know how sound travels and which materials are most effective to prevent this from occurring. In addition, you should to ensure that your windows are correctly installed and made of top-quality materials.
